Hello Peter,

you can reproduce it like this:

1. create a tag with any name.

2. rename the tag to "XX::fun to be, XX::fun" (enter this complete string) by 
right-clicking the tag in the browser window

3. Two tags will be created: "XX::fun to be, XX" and "XX::fun to be, XX::fun" 
(note, the first tag's name contains a comma)

I can't reproduce the error though, but the tag's name contains a comma.

A bug:

I have tried to rename a tag with a space and another tag. The result has been 
one tag with a comma in it's name and another tag inside.

XX::fun to be, XX::fun

Another problem:

There are untagged cards a the end of the "all tags" tag. When I click on this 
tag, I get an error message (browse_cards_dlg.py line 839 in update_filter, see 
photo attached)

By the way:

1. Autocomplete for tags doesn't work, when you rename a tag.
2. Autocomplete for tags should not add a comma.
